LOG IN
SIGN UP
Tech Job Finder - Find Software, Technology Sales and Product Manager Jobs.
Sign In
OR continue with e-mail and password
E-mail address
Password
Don't have an account?
Reset password
Join Tech Job Finder
OR continue with e-mail and password
E-mail address
First name
Last name
Username
Password
Confirm Password
How did you hear about us?
By signing up, you agree to our Terms & Conditions and Privacy Policy.

Software Engineer III - LLM Developer

at J.P. Morgan

Back to all Data Science / AI / ML jobs
J.P. Morgan logo
Bulge Bracket Investment Banks

Software Engineer III - LLM Developer

at J.P. Morgan

Mid LevelNo visa sponsorshipData Science/AI/ML

Posted a month ago

No clicks

Compensation
Not specified

Currency: Not specified

City
Bengaluru
Country
India

As a Software Engineer III (LLM Developer) at JPMorgan Chase you will design, deploy and manage ML and GenAI-driven solutions for consumer and community banking. You'll build CI/CD pipelines, model deployment and inference infrastructure on AWS (SageMaker/Bedrock), implement MLOps best practices, and ensure production stability, monitoring, and security. The role requires coding in Python/Java, Infrastructure-as-Code (Terraform), containerization (Docker/Kubernetes), and experience with ML frameworks such as TensorFlow and PyTorch. You will collaborate with ML engineers, product managers, and platform teams to scale and improve ML platform features.

Location: Bengaluru, Karnataka, India

Description

We have an exciting and rewarding opportunity for you to take your software engineering career to the next level. 

As a Software Engineer III at JPMorgan Chase within the Consumer and community banking technology team, you serve as a seasoned member of an agile team to design and deliver trusted market-leading technology products in a secure, stable, and scalable way. You are responsible for carrying out critical technology solutions across multiple technical areas within various business functions in support of the firm’s business objectives.

Job responsibilities

  • Oversee setting direction, development, and implementation of  ML and GenAI driven solutions
  • Develop codes and automations to provision and manage cloud infrastructure and services required for model serving and inferencing.
  • Create pipelines for model and pipeline deployment and execute them for CI/CD process.
  • Deploy and manage  Machine Learning platform and platform features in production. 
  • Be responsible for stability, reliability, security and production run books of the machine learning solution in production.
  • Be responsible for registering the models artifacts, maintaining code coverage, implementing functional and non-functional tests in the pipeline and maintaining CI/CD frameworks.
  • Collaborate with Machine Learning engineers, product managers, key business stakeholders, engineering, and platform partners to deploy projects that deliver cutting-edge machine learning-driven digital solutions.
  • Communicate and collaborate with Platform and Engineering partners to bring in the latest advancements in order to improve the scale, consistency, reliability and trustworthiness of the ML solutions

Required qualifications, capabilities, and skills

  • Formal training or certification on software engineering concepts and 3+ years applied experience.
  • Proven experience in deploying AI/ML applications in a production environment, with skills in deploying models on AWS platforms such as SageMaker or Bedrock.
  • Proven experience with MLOps practices, encompassing the full cycle from design, experimentation, deployment, to monitoring and maintenance of machine learning models.
  • Demonstrated expertise in deploying solutions involving machine learning frameworks: Tensorflow, Pytorch, pyG, Keras and Scikit-Learn.
  • Expert skill in system monitoring tools like Apica, Dynatrace, Grafana etc.
  • Expert skill in CI/CD tools like Jenkins, Spinnaker, Git, Bitbucket etc.
  • Expert in Infrastructure as a code frameworks i.e. Terraform, EaC (Environment as Code) 
  • Proficiency in programming languages such as Python or Java etc.
  • Expert knowledge of one of the cloud computing platforms : Amazon Web Services (AWS), containerization technologies (Docker, Kubernetes, Amazon EKS, ECS)
  • Working proficiency in one of the end to end Machine Learning framework or tool i.e. MLFlow, Kubeflow, sagemaker studio, Databricks etc

 

Preferred qualifications, capabilities, and skills

  • Good understanding of AI/ML algorithms and techniques, including deep learning, reinforcement learning, and natural language processing (NLP).
  • Experience with Kubernetes based platform for Training or Inferencing.
  • Experience of building and managing large scale feature stores.
  • Proficiency in writing comprehensive test cases, with a strong emphasis on using testing frameworks such as pytest to ensure code quality and reliability.
  • Understanding of finance or investment banking businesses is an added advantage.
Design and deliver market-leading technology products in a secure and scalable way as a seasoned member of an agile team

Software Engineer III - LLM Developer

at J.P. Morgan

Back to all Data Science / AI / ML jobs
J.P. Morgan logo
Bulge Bracket Investment Banks

Software Engineer III - LLM Developer

at J.P. Morgan

Mid LevelNo visa sponsorshipData Science/AI/ML

Posted a month ago

No clicks

Compensation
Not specified

Currency: Not specified

City
Bengaluru
Country
India

As a Software Engineer III (LLM Developer) at JPMorgan Chase you will design, deploy and manage ML and GenAI-driven solutions for consumer and community banking. You'll build CI/CD pipelines, model deployment and inference infrastructure on AWS (SageMaker/Bedrock), implement MLOps best practices, and ensure production stability, monitoring, and security. The role requires coding in Python/Java, Infrastructure-as-Code (Terraform), containerization (Docker/Kubernetes), and experience with ML frameworks such as TensorFlow and PyTorch. You will collaborate with ML engineers, product managers, and platform teams to scale and improve ML platform features.

Location: Bengaluru, Karnataka, India

Description

We have an exciting and rewarding opportunity for you to take your software engineering career to the next level. 

As a Software Engineer III at JPMorgan Chase within the Consumer and community banking technology team, you serve as a seasoned member of an agile team to design and deliver trusted market-leading technology products in a secure, stable, and scalable way. You are responsible for carrying out critical technology solutions across multiple technical areas within various business functions in support of the firm’s business objectives.

Job responsibilities

  • Oversee setting direction, development, and implementation of  ML and GenAI driven solutions
  • Develop codes and automations to provision and manage cloud infrastructure and services required for model serving and inferencing.
  • Create pipelines for model and pipeline deployment and execute them for CI/CD process.
  • Deploy and manage  Machine Learning platform and platform features in production. 
  • Be responsible for stability, reliability, security and production run books of the machine learning solution in production.
  • Be responsible for registering the models artifacts, maintaining code coverage, implementing functional and non-functional tests in the pipeline and maintaining CI/CD frameworks.
  • Collaborate with Machine Learning engineers, product managers, key business stakeholders, engineering, and platform partners to deploy projects that deliver cutting-edge machine learning-driven digital solutions.
  • Communicate and collaborate with Platform and Engineering partners to bring in the latest advancements in order to improve the scale, consistency, reliability and trustworthiness of the ML solutions

Required qualifications, capabilities, and skills

  • Formal training or certification on software engineering concepts and 3+ years applied experience.
  • Proven experience in deploying AI/ML applications in a production environment, with skills in deploying models on AWS platforms such as SageMaker or Bedrock.
  • Proven experience with MLOps practices, encompassing the full cycle from design, experimentation, deployment, to monitoring and maintenance of machine learning models.
  • Demonstrated expertise in deploying solutions involving machine learning frameworks: Tensorflow, Pytorch, pyG, Keras and Scikit-Learn.
  • Expert skill in system monitoring tools like Apica, Dynatrace, Grafana etc.
  • Expert skill in CI/CD tools like Jenkins, Spinnaker, Git, Bitbucket etc.
  • Expert in Infrastructure as a code frameworks i.e. Terraform, EaC (Environment as Code) 
  • Proficiency in programming languages such as Python or Java etc.
  • Expert knowledge of one of the cloud computing platforms : Amazon Web Services (AWS), containerization technologies (Docker, Kubernetes, Amazon EKS, ECS)
  • Working proficiency in one of the end to end Machine Learning framework or tool i.e. MLFlow, Kubeflow, sagemaker studio, Databricks etc

 

Preferred qualifications, capabilities, and skills

  • Good understanding of AI/ML algorithms and techniques, including deep learning, reinforcement learning, and natural language processing (NLP).
  • Experience with Kubernetes based platform for Training or Inferencing.
  • Experience of building and managing large scale feature stores.
  • Proficiency in writing comprehensive test cases, with a strong emphasis on using testing frameworks such as pytest to ensure code quality and reliability.
  • Understanding of finance or investment banking businesses is an added advantage.
Design and deliver market-leading technology products in a secure and scalable way as a seasoned member of an agile team